Zotero PDF Translate插件侧边栏翻译窗口布局问题分析

Zotero PDF Translate插件侧边栏翻译窗口布局问题分析

【免费下载链接】zotero-pdf-translate 支持将PDF、EPub、网页内容、元数据、注释和笔记翻译为目标语言,并且兼容20多种翻译服务。 【免费下载链接】zotero-pdf-translate 项目地址: https://gitcode.com/gh_mirrors/zo/zotero-pdf-translate

Zotero PDF Translate插件是一款功能强大的文献翻译工具,但在最新版本中出现了一个影响用户体验的界面布局问题。本文将从技术角度分析该问题的成因及解决方案。

问题现象

在Windows 10系统环境下,使用Zotero 7.0 beta83版本配合PDF Translate插件1.1.0 beta44版本时,用户发现侧边栏翻译功能中的"打开独立窗口"按钮占据了近半个屏幕的空间。这种异常的UI元素尺寸严重影响了翻译内容的显示区域,降低了工具的使用效率。

技术分析

从界面截图可以看出,该问题属于典型的CSS样式失效或冲突导致的布局异常。在Web开发中,按钮元素通常会通过CSS样式表控制其尺寸和位置。当样式表未能正确加载或应用时,浏览器会回退到默认渲染方式,导致元素尺寸失控。

解决方案

开发团队在收到问题报告后迅速响应,通过以下方式解决了该问题:

  1. 重新检查了按钮组件的CSS样式定义,确保其尺寸参数正确
  2. 验证了样式表在Zotero环境中的加载顺序和优先级
  3. 修复了可能导致样式冲突的代码逻辑

该修复已在1.1.0-beta.45版本中发布,用户只需更新插件即可恢复正常使用体验。

最佳实践建议

对于类似前端UI问题的排查,建议采用以下方法:

  1. 使用开发者工具检查元素样式应用情况
  2. 确认CSS选择器优先级是否正确
  3. 检查是否有动态样式覆盖导致的问题
  4. 在不同分辨率下测试布局响应性

Zotero PDF Translate插件作为学术研究辅助工具,其用户体验的持续优化对提高研究效率具有重要意义。开发团队对用户反馈的快速响应也体现了开源项目的协作优势。

【免费下载链接】zotero-pdf-translate 支持将PDF、EPub、网页内容、元数据、注释和笔记翻译为目标语言,并且兼容20多种翻译服务。 【免费下载链接】zotero-pdf-translate 项目地址: https://gitcode.com/gh_mirrors/zo/zotero-pdf-translate

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值